We recently "discovered" the same thing. CCR is programed so that any inquiry is viewed by their system as making a change; they can not differentiate between an inquiry only and an update (institutional information). Lucky for our office, we were checking to make sure that an update that we had submitted had been made and we were checking several weeks before an application was to be submitted.
